M S Subbulakshmi's concert at the Music Academy, Madras, on the evening of 29th December, 1963. She was accompanied by

Radha Viswanathan - Vocal Support

Thiruvalangadu N Sundaresa Iyer - Violin

Chalakkudy N S Narayanaswamy - Violin

T K Murthy - Mridangam

Umayalpuram Kodhandarama Iyer - Ghatam

This concert is extremely unique due to the presence of 2 violin vidwans! The Music Academy records state that the scheduled violin vidwan for this concert was Sri Chalakkudy Narayanaswamy. With deference to Sri Sundaresa Iyer's seniority, Sri Chalakkudy Narayanaswamy literally plays "second fiddle" to the senior vidwan in a most admirable and unobtrusive manner.

Note: There is a marked drop in the quality of track 8, due to a physical defect in the original tape. We have remastered the music to the best possible extent. Also, a major portion of the tanam is missing from track 10, possibly due to changing tape sides.
